HOW MANY TOYOTA CELICA T SPORT VVTLI ARE LEFT?

There are 935 TOYOTA CELICA T SPORT VVTLI left on the road in the UK (i.e. with valid road tax). There are a further 712 TOYOTA CELICA T SPORT VVTLI that are currently SORNED.

The total number of TOYOTA CELICA T SPORT VVTLI was highest during 2006 Q4 (3,164). The number taxed topped out in 2006 Q4 and the total SORNed was at its maximum during 2024 Q3.

Since the total peaked, some 1,517 (48%) TOYOTA CELICA T SPORT VVTLI have been scrapped or exported.

In the last 10 years the total number of TOYOTA CELICA T SPORT VVTLI has fallen by 1,213. Licensed models have fallen by 1,787 and the SORNed total has increased by 574.

The 5 year trend shows a total decline of 569 TOYOTA CELICA T SPORT VVTLI models. Taxed models have declined by 762 and the SORNed total has increased by 193.

57% of the surviving 1,647 TOYOTA CELICA T SPORT VVTLI in the UK are still on the road.
